Home / Rpc servers
98 Components & Libraries
Sortby
A screenshot of a Windows client connecting to a Linux server.
This library currently only supports the following BERT-RPC features: Install from PyPI: Import the library and create an RPC client: Note that the underlying BERT-RPC transaction of the above call i…
Spyne aims to save the protocol implementers the hassle of implementing their own remote procedure call api and the application programmers the hassle of jumping through hoops just to expose their se…
This library is an implementation of the JSON-RPC specification. It supports both the original 1.0 specification, as well as the new (proposed) 2.0 spec, which includes batch submission, keyword argu…
This library is an implementation of both the JSON-RPC and the XML-RPC specification (server-side) for the Tornado web framework. It supports the basic features of both, as well as the MultiCall / Ba…
An implementation of the standard WordPress API methods is provided, but the library is designed for easy integration with custom XML-RPC API methods provided by plugins. This library was developed a…
A Python library that exports a class for RPC via zmq, using BSON for data interchange. zmqrpc is registered at pypi. Install using pip or easy_install: $> pip install zmqrpc Go for it, fork away …
install via pip: Pulsar design allows for a host of different asynchronous applications to be implemented in an elegant and efficient way. Out of the box it is shipped with the the following: More in…
AuthServiceProxy is an improved version of python-jsonrpc. It includes the following generic improvements: It also includes the following bitcoin-specific details: Note: This will only install bitcoi…
A JSON-RPC 2.0 implementation for Python (Python 3 not supported yet) Alternatively, one can use the following commands from the directory which contains the 'setup.py' file.
WebSocket & WAMP for Python on Twisted and asyncio. Note Here is a simple WebSocket Echo Server that will echo back any WebSocket message received: Here is a WAMP Application Component that perfo…
json-rpc2php is a flexible PHP JSON-RPC2 server.it contains the following: The json-RPC2 PHP server a json-RPC2 client in PHP a json-RPC2 client in Javascript (using jQuery) a json-RPC2 client in Pyt…
Supports Python 2.7 and 3.3+. There are various classes, assuming different JSON-RPC 2.0 and ZeroMQ characteristics. The above, for example, will connect a REQ socket to the given endpoint. Given a s…
Pushy is an RPC (Remote Procedure Call) package for Python and Java. The key feature of Pushy is that it only requiresPython and an SSH daemon on the "server". You don't need to install anything on t…
Searpc is a simple C language RPC framework based on GObject system. Searpc handles the serialization/deserialization part of RPC, the transport part is left to users. The serialization/deserializati…
Links: Other resources: Python-EPC is tested against Python 2.6, 2.7, 3.2 and 3.3. Python-EPC is licensed under GPL v3. See COPYING for details.
MessagePack RPC implementation based on Tornado. or In test directory: Run with timeout test(Timeout test takes about 5 seconds) Test code are available in example directory(bench_client.py and bench…
This is an implementation of the Robust Principal Components algorithm from [1] in Python. The numpy library is used for basic matrix manipulation and SVD implementations. The optimisation algorithm …
pycapnp has additional development dependencies, including cython and pytest. See requirements.txt for them all. Or you can clone the repo like so: By default, the setup script will automatically use…
MTMonkey is a simple and easily adaptable infrastructure forMachine Translation web services, written in Python.It allows clients JSON-encoded request for different translation directionsto be distri…
If you like my work, please consider donating: BTC 18ZcxHsKnc4a1AhnThQ2tiLVjQehxKaGFX Copyright (c) 2013 Thomas Sileo Permission is hereby granted, free of charge, to any person obtaining a copy of t…
This is an essential part of the library as there are a lot of edge cases in JSON-RPC standard. To manage a variety of supported python versions as well as optional backends json-rpc uses tox: Tip Du…
To install mprpc, simply: Alternatively,
Pythonic bidirectional-rpc API built on top of ØMQ with pluggableencryption, authentication and heartbeating support. Back on server side, we can send to it any commands the client is able to do.
Python library with tools for Bitcoin and other cryptocurrencies. Litecoin, Namecoin, Peercoin, Primecoin, Testnet, Worldcoin, Megacoin, Feathercoin, Terracoin, Novacoin, Dogecoin, Anoncoin, Protosha…
Because of the use of UDP, you will not always know whether or not a procedure call was successfully received. This isn't considered an exception state in the library, though you will know if a resp…
pyaria2 is a Python 3 module that provides a wrapper class around Aria2's RPC interface. It can be used to build applications that use Aria2 for downloading data. aria2 is a lightweight multi-protoco…
Subscribe to our newsletter